About Michael
Dr Michael Vallely is a Chancellor’s Fellow at the Scottish Centre for Employment Research at the University of Strathclyde. His primary research interests are social class and labour market outcomes. Prior to Michael's current role, he was a Postdoctoral Research Fellow at the Economic and Social Research Institute, during which he was awarded a European Consortium for Sociological Research Visitor Grant to carry out a research visit at Pompeu Fabra University.
He completed his PhD in Economics at the University of Glasgow, and during this carried out research visits at Universitat Autonoma de Barcelona and the University of Sydney, and was awarded the Hughes Hallett Scholarship for the academic year 2022-23.
Michael holds a Masters of Research in Sociology & Research Methods and a BA (Hons) in Accountancy. He previously worked as an Associate Tutor and Research Assistant at the University of Glasgow, Researcher at the University of Strathclyde, Occasional Lecturer at Glasgow Caledonian University and Research Officer at the Scottish Government.
